Manganese steel wear liners

Austenitic manganese steel – steel alloyed with more than 10% manganese – is work-hardening. That means that high impacts – like those in a crushing chamber for example – cause the formation of a extremely hard surface layer that is two to three times harder than the rest of the alloy If impacted enough, this results in a hard exterior layer backed by a …

Mantle & Bowl Liner | Premium Cone Crusher Liners

Cone crushers are widely used in the mining and aggregates industries to reduce the size of blasted rock by compressing the material between two manganese liners: the mantle and the bowl liner (concave ring). The mantle covers the cone head to protect it from wear; we can see it as a sacial wear liner that sits on the cone head.

Type of crushers and their difference

The jaw crusher is usually made of cast steel because it is such a heavy-duty machine. Its outer frame is generally made of cast iron or steel. While the jaws themselves are usually constructed from cast steel. They are fitted with replaceable liners which are made of manganese steel, or Ni-hard (a Ni-Cr alloyed cast iron).

Crusher Wear Parts and Liners |

Manganese steel has been used in crusher wear parts for decades because of its work-hardening properties. As rocks meet the surface of the manganese steel its exterior layer hardens. This results in a material that is harder to wear down during operation and can handle higher impact blows compared to other alloys.
